The ingredients needed to make Dal Khichdi:
  1. Take 1/2 cup Rice
  2. Get 1/2 cup Moong Dal soaked
  3. Make ready 1/4 teaspoon Turmeric powder
  4. Prepare 1 teaspoon Salt
  5. Make ready 1/8 teaspoon hing powder
  6. Make ready 1 teaspoon Ghee
  7. Take 1 teaspoon Oil
  8. Prepare 1/2 teaspoon Cumin seeds
  9. Make ready 1/2 teaspoon Mustard seeds
  10. Make ready 1 teaspoon Finely chopped ginger
  11. Prepare 1 green chilli, finely chopped
  12. Get 1 large Tomato, chopped
  13. Take 1/4 cup Green peas

Instructions to make Dal Khichdi:
  1. Instructions - Take 1/2 cup rice and 1/2 cup moong dal in a bowl. - Soak it in enough water for 20 minutes. After 20 minutes, drain the water and set it aside. - Add the rice and dal to a pressure cooker and add around 3.5 to 4 cups water.
  2. Add salt, turmeric powder and asafoetida and pressure cook on high heat for 5- whistles. - The rice and dal will cook and be very soft and mushy, set aside. - To another pan on medium heat, add ghee and oil. You may use only oil to keep it vegan.
  3. Once the oil & ghee is hot, add cumin seeds and mustard seeds. Wait till cumin seeds start sizzling and mustard seeds pop up. - Add chopped ginger and green chilli. Saute for 30 seconds or so or till the ginger starts turning light golden brown in colour.
  4. Add chopped tomatoes and green peas. Cook for 2 minutes, you don't want the tomatoes to get too mushy. - Add the cooked rice and dal to the pan. - Mix till well combined, add salt and adjust to taste.
  5. Garnish with cilantro and serve the moong dal khichdi with some extra ghee on top. Also, it's usually served with some papad, achar (pickle) and yogurt on the side.

Khichdi (pronounced [ˈkʰɪtʃɽi]) is a dish in South Asian cuisine made of rice and lentils (dal), but other variations include bajra and mung dal kichri. Dal Khichdi is an Indian style lentil and rice one-pot dish.
